Harry Potter is one of my go-to comfort movies when I need a dose of nostalgia. I own a replica of Hermione Granger's Yule Ball earrings, and my Harry Potter Funko figurine sits in my room at all times — including during my Zoom call with Tom Felton. He's excited about Funko's newest collab with Kinder Joy, but is maybe less so about my Harry Potter house scarf, which confirms I'm a Ravenclaw instead of a Slytherin like him ("That looks blue to me," the actor, who played Draco Malfoy, jokes).

He might tease his cast mates on Instagram for the fact they're also not in Slytherin, but rest assured, it's all in good fun. "There's definitely a group chat, I'm pretty sure it's titled Potterheads," he says with a smile. "It sounds cheesy [but] we do feel like a family. So it's great to see any of them. I golf with the Weasley twins [James and Oliver Phelps] a lot. When I'm lucky enough to see Dan [Radcliffe] in his new plays, it's always great. Rupert [Grint] lives around the corner from me in London, so I see him quite frequently."

Image via Stephen Lovekin/Getty Images

Reconnecting with the rest of the cast of Harry Potter isn't the only thing that transports Tom Felton back in time — seeing his brand new Funko does too! "Usually when someone...shows me a new version, I'm just like, 'Where did you get it?'" he says. "There's one of Draco in his Quidditch outfit, which immediately takes me back to my broomstick days. But they all have their own unique little charms."

Funko is currently collaborating with Kinder Joy, which Tom and I agree feels like the muggle version of the Hogwarts Express trolley ("You get excited about the chocolate, and then after that, you get the Easter egg surprise inside"). He also says both brands bring up plenty of memories from his 10-year stretch at Hogwarts.

Image via Warner Bros.

And as it turns out, Tom Felton and I have very vivid memories around the same movie: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ince. My local children's museum hung larger-than-life posters promoting the film, and I remember feeling how much emotional weight this particular movie held, especially as we neared the end of the story. The 2009 film catapulted the series into its final two installments, and played a huge role in Draco Malfoy's arc.

"[At the time,] we weren't privy to where our characters were going so all I did really was just focus on who [Draco] was in that particular film," Tom says. "Which is why shooting Half-Blood Prince was probably the most enjoyable. To see the the reason why Draco is, well, the way he is, I thought it was very impactful and I'm amazed at the subtleties that fans pick up on now about his story. It's a very multi-layered character."

Image via Dan Kitwood/Getty Images

While Tom Felton says Draco's not a good guy, he also believes the character doesn't want to end up like his father. "I think he would rather make peace than start another fight," he tells me. "He's done enough fighting...I think it's time that he chilled out a bit."

For his own relaxation, Tom recently made a trip to the Harry Potter Studio Tour in Leavesden (where the cast filmed the series) "just to sort of pop in and see home."

"I spent like three hours...just walking around and seeing how much people enjoy it," he says. "There was a teenager with her mom taking a picture of my costume and I couldn't help but photo bomb thinking it was, you know, a nice surprise or it would be funny. But I was quickly ushered [away] by her mom saying, 'Would you mind?' So I thought that was quite funny."

Even if you haven't made the trip to London to see the Studios in person, you probably recognize them from Max's Harry Potter 20th Anniversary: Return to Hogwarts special, where Tom Felton reunited with the rest of the Harry Potter cast.

"I think the 20-year reunion was the reminder of, crikey time flies," he continues. "We're all bona fide adults now, but still feel like kids, I think, at heart because as soon as you put us all in the room together, we just go back to who we were when we first met. So that's a nice feeling."

I have such a love/hate relationship with haircuts. While I love the feeling of a fresh look as much as the next girl, I hate having to spend $100+ for a simple cut and blow dry session. During my recent trim, I talked with my hairdresser, Jack Rehak of Jack’s Hair Design in Hinsdale, Illinois, about ways to keep a haircut looking new and best practices for keeping hair healthy. Here's what he had to say!

Here's How Often You Should Cut Your Hair, According To Professionals

Photo by cottonbro studio/PEXELS

I’ll admit it — it had been eight months since my last haircut. My hair had lost its shape, my layers were nowhere to be found, and my ends were begging for mercy. Life got busy over the last few months and I was neglecting my haircare like never before.

My hairdresser could immediately see that I was beyond due for a cut and said I needed to get more taken off than I was hoping. I was definitely disappointed — I'd been working on growing out my hair for a while now, and it just felt like my hard work had completely gone to waste. He explained that getting consistent haircuts is the key to growing out healthy and strong hair, rather than letting it grow and grow until it eventually breaks. So let's dig into the top three things you can do to avoid this scenario!

1. Just Get The Dang Haircut

Photo by RDNE Stock project/PEXELS

Also avoiding a haircut like I was? You might want to schedule one at your nearest salon. Like my stylist said, when you wait too long between trims like I did, you risk your hair becoming heavy, dull, and lifeless. When the hair is dry or even dead, it’s nearly impossible for it to hold a curl or style, essentially collapsing on you and taking on more and more heat damage all the while. I know the pain of spending time on a blowout only for it to fall minutes later — it’s the worst.

According to Jack, getting a haircut every 10-12 weeks is the best time frame or your ends will pay the price. Between blow-drying, curling, straightening, sun, and weather, our ends get dry and start to break without the proper care. Getting consistent haircuts allows hair to bounce back, shine, and perform the way we want in a healthy way.
